e9d6193dfd
Replace fmt.Errorf() with errors.Errorf() in the cli
...
Signed-off-by: Daniel Nephin <dnephin@docker.com >
2017-03-24 16:58:07 -04:00
c1b2fad9aa
Fix external volume error to pass validation.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com >
2017-03-24 16:55:04 -04:00
c70387aebc
Cleanup compose convert error messages.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com >
2017-03-24 10:43:28 -04:00
7e6c7a52ce
Merge pull request #32042 from vdemeester/compose-interpolate-error-instead-of-panic
...
[compose/interpolation] Make sure we error out instead of panic during interpolation
2017-03-24 09:00:06 +01:00
8a16f32da7
Merge pull request #31986 from Microsoft/jjh/fix28267
...
Windows: Don't close client stdin handle to avoid hang
2017-03-23 16:35:54 +01:00
fe19bc6891
Make sure we error out instead of panic during interpolation
...
Use type assertion to error out if the type isn't the right one
instead of panic as before this change.
Signed-off-by: Vincent Demeester <vincent@sbr.pm >
2017-03-23 16:09:57 +01:00
019d27350b
Merge pull request #32002 from vdemeester/compose-remove-type-dict
...
Remove compose types.Dict alias
2017-03-22 23:08:09 +01:00
a1e1ab78d0
Remove compose types.Dict alias
...
It is just an alias type and make the code a little bit more complex
and hard to use from outside `compose` package.
Signed-off-by: Vincent Demeester <vincent@sbr.pm >
2017-03-22 16:16:20 +01:00
82b04969b7
Return proper exit code on builder panic
...
Signed-off-by: Tonis Tiigi <tonistiigi@gmail.com >
2017-03-21 19:09:23 -07:00
e8be542957
Windows: Don't close client stdin handle to avoid hang
...
Signed-off-by: John Howard (VM) <jhoward@microsoft.com >
2017-03-21 16:00:17 -07:00
6bc233965e
Merge pull request #31705 from cyli/bump-go-connections
...
Use either a system pool or custom CA pool when connecting from client->daemon (+go-connections version bump)
2017-03-21 10:36:41 -07:00
250c3f0db2
Merge pull request #31621 from dnephin/cleanup-container-run-command
...
Some cleanup of container run command
2017-03-21 16:01:11 +01:00
e1409013e5
Merge pull request #31552 from ripcurld0/add_format_secretls
...
Add format to secret ls
2017-03-20 20:20:45 +01:00
586412ce39
Merge pull request #31948 from vdemeester/compose-typo
...
Fixing a small typo in compose loader package
2017-03-20 17:48:50 +01:00
4826a5c3af
Fixing a small typo in compose loader package
...
Signed-off-by: Vincent Demeester <vincent@sbr.pm >
2017-03-20 15:39:57 +01:00
cc44dec589
fixed:go vetting warning unkeyed fields
...
Signed-off-by: Aaron.L.Xu <liker.xu@foxmail.com >
2017-03-20 16:30:01 +08:00
1bac314da5
Add format to secret ls
...
Signed-off-by: Boaz Shuster <ripcurld.github@gmail.com >
2017-03-19 09:22:30 +02:00
6e24fc3f58
Merge pull request #30781 from AkihiroSuda/fix-stack-env
...
compose: fix environment interpolation from the client
2017-03-17 15:56:50 +01:00
2fc6cd4b71
compose: update the comment about MappingWithEquals
...
Signed-off-by: Akihiro Suda <suda.akihiro@lab.ntt.co.jp >
2017-03-17 06:21:55 +00:00
2222824fd9
Merge pull request #31896 from aaronlehmann/move-secretrequestoption
...
api: Remove SecretRequestOption type
2017-03-16 21:31:15 +01:00
a3a3e2dba6
Merge pull request #31886 from daniel48/master
...
fix a typo
2017-03-16 21:30:22 +01:00
1aca09b8cc
Merge pull request #31894 from dnephin/fix-schema-id
...
Fix compose schema id for v3.2
2017-03-16 21:19:59 +01:00
395081fc6b
api: Remove SecretRequestOption type
...
This type is only used by CLI code. It duplicates SecretReference in the
types/swarm package. Change the CLI code to use that type instead.
Signed-off-by: Aaron Lehmann <aaron.lehmann@docker.com >
2017-03-16 11:20:31 -07:00
d0fb25319b
Fix compose schema id for v3.2
...
Signed-off-by: Daniel Nephin <dnephin@docker.com >
2017-03-16 13:53:58 -04:00
7fe0d2d64d
fix a typo
...
when i was using:
docker search --automated -s 3 nginx
told me:
Flag --automated has been deprecated, use --filter=automated=true instead
Flag --stars has been deprecated, use --filter=stars=3 instead
and when i use:
docker search --filter=automated=true --filter=stars=3 nginx
told me:
Error response from daemon: Invalid filter 'automated'
and i found out that the correct command should be:
docker search --filter=is-automated=true --filter=stars=3 nginx
Signed-off-by: Pure White <daniel48@126.com >
2017-03-16 23:11:57 +08:00
d5d0d7795b
Add missing API version annotations to commands
...
Signed-off-by: Sebastiaan van Stijn <github@gone.nl >
2017-03-16 13:40:12 +01:00
96551fee53
Merge pull request #31775 from erxian/misleading-default-for-update-monitor-duration-flag
...
misleading default for --update-monitor duration
2017-03-16 10:13:26 +01:00
d4ed696179
Merge pull request #31866 from gdevillele/pr_service_create
...
improve semantics of utility function in cli/command/service
2017-03-16 10:12:15 +01:00
4031d93f61
Merge pull request #31057 from krasi-georgiev/30779-fix-client-login-credentials-save-domain
...
fix incorect login client credential save when the registry is the default docker registry
2017-03-16 13:19:32 +09:00
59c79325bc
improve semantics of utility function in cli/command/service
...
Signed-off-by: Gaetan de Villele <gdevillele@gmail.com >
2017-03-15 13:49:52 -07:00
bc771127d8
Revert "Planned 1.13 deprecation: email from login"
...
This reverts commit a66efbddb8eaa837cf42aae20b76c08274271dcf.
Signed-off-by: Victor Vieux <victorvieux@gmail.com >
2017-03-15 10:43:18 -07:00
69b7bf5e9f
Merge pull request #31302 from dnephin/purge-orphaned-services
...
Add --prune to stack deploy
2017-03-15 12:57:06 +01:00
88a99ae70e
misleading default for --update-monitor duration
...
Signed-off-by: erxian <evelynhsu21@gmail.com >
2017-03-15 14:20:02 +08:00
d510306bb7
Merge pull request #31147 from adshmh/30629-print-escaping-hint-on-invalid-interpolation-format
...
docker stack deploy interpolation format error due to not escaping $ now includes a hint
2017-03-14 17:14:09 -07:00
b1a98b55af
Add --prune to stack deploy.
...
Add to command line reference.
Signed-off-by: Daniel Nephin <dnephin@docker.com >
2017-03-14 16:09:28 -04:00
146d3eb304
Fix environment resolving.
...
Load from env should only happen if the value is unset.
Extract a buildEnvironment function and revert some changes to tests.
Signed-off-by: Daniel Nephin <dnephin@docker.com >
2017-03-14 16:00:43 -04:00
b7ffa960bf
compose: fix environment interpolation from the client
...
For an environment variable defined in the yaml without value,
the value needs to be propagated from the client, as in Docker Compose.
Signed-off-by: Akihiro Suda <suda.akihiro@lab.ntt.co.jp >
2017-03-14 15:59:40 -04:00
5ce6afc459
Merge pull request #31809 from vieux/bump_api
...
bump API to 1.28
2017-03-14 11:53:52 -07:00
d1fc5acc2e
Merge pull request #31795 from dnephin/compose-file-v3.2
...
Compose file v3.2
2017-03-14 14:10:24 -04:00
b8c49df008
Merge pull request #30597 from dnephin/add-expanded-mount-format-to-stack-deploy
...
Add expanded mount format to stack deploy
2017-03-14 17:53:28 +00:00
a972d43e48
bump API to 1.28
...
Signed-off-by: Victor Vieux <victorvieux@gmail.com >
2017-03-14 09:32:50 -07:00
7ce0cb0cf0
Merge pull request #31500 from dperny/fix-service-logs-cli
...
Add tail and since to service logs
2017-03-14 14:19:29 +01:00
5ad1cebf78
Merge pull request #31710 from sanimej/drillerrr
...
Add verbose flag to network inspect to show all services & tasks in swarm mode
2017-03-13 21:12:32 -07:00
6c7da0ca57
Enhance network inspect to show all tasks, local & non-local, in swarm mode
...
Signed-off-by: Santhosh Manohar <santhosh@docker.com >
2017-03-13 17:52:08 -07:00
8b3bfc15c3
Merge pull request #31672 from dperny/service-logs-formatting
...
Service logs formatting
2017-03-13 19:08:55 -04:00
2e9b15143a
Add compose file version 3.2
...
Signed-off-by: Daniel Nephin <dnephin@docker.com >
2017-03-13 16:20:42 -04:00
4e388c22d3
Refactor container run cli command.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com >
2017-03-13 16:05:51 -04:00
33bfb1e5e5
Move endpoint_mode under deploy and add it to the schema.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com >
2017-03-13 15:00:56 -04:00
cd1cde6e77
support both endpoint modes in stack
...
Signed-off-by: allencloud <allen.sun@daocloud.io >
2017-03-13 15:00:49 -04:00
b786563826
Merge pull request #31579 from ijc25/cpuacct
...
Correct CPU usage calculation in presence of offline CPUs and newer Linux
2017-03-13 16:32:18 +00:00